Understanding Double Glazing
Before delving into the options, it is necessary to recognize what double glazing entails and the mechanics behind it. Double-glazed windows consist of two sheets (or panes) of glass with a spacer bar that separates them. The space in between the panes is often filled with argon, krypton, or simply air, offering insulation from external temperature levels. This technology not just helps maintain a comfy indoor environment however also adds to energy performance and lowers energy expenses.

There are different choices when it concerns choosing double glazing for domestic properties. Each type has special functions, benefits, and aesthetics.
Type of Double GlazingFeaturesAdvantagesuPVC WindowsMade from unplasticized polyvinyl chloride, these frames are resilient and low upkeep.Budget-friendly and energy-efficient, with excellent thermal insulation.Aluminum WindowsLightweight yet strong, aluminum frames can be powder-coated for visual customization.Resilient with a modern appearance, provides good thermal efficiency when thermal breaks are included.Timber WindowsTraditional wooden frames supply a traditional visual.Exceptional insulation properties and adjustable finishes, offering high aesthetic appeal, though they need more maintenance.Composite WindowsIntegrate the benefits of wood and PVC, including a strong wood core with a durable outer cladding product.Offer strength, sturdiness, and aesthetic appeal, requiring very little maintenance.Triple GlazingCombines 3 panes of glass rather of 2, leading to much better insulation.[best double glazing installers](https://pad.stuve.uni-ulm.de/DzH4dJYeR6mIBlkdnxv2dQ/) matched for very cold environments or energy-efficient homes.Elements to Consider When Choosing Double Glazing

How Do I Know if My Windows Need Replacing?
Indications consist of drafts, condensation between panes, difficulty opening or closing, or obvious temperature fluctuations near windows.

4. Is Double Glazing Suitable for Every Home?
While double glazing is appropriate for the majority of homes, unique architectural features or listed buildings may require options or special consents.
5. How Does Double Glazing Help with Noise Reduction?
The two panes of glass, specifically when utilizing thicker or laminated ranges, function as sound barriers, successfully minimizing outdoors noise transfer into the home.
